Teams will be âqueueing upâ for Premier League manager who Chelsea arenât so keen on
Chelseaâs hunt for a new manager could line up perfectly with Eddie Howeâs departure from Newcastle, and one pundit would like that.

Football fans are often keen to see their manager sacked, especially when things really arenât working out.
But often, once it comes to looking at the list of favourites to replace the fired coach, they end up having second thoughts. Is this really better than what we already had?
Chelsea fans almost universally wanted Liam Rosenior fired â but weâre not sure many of them would be happy were he replaced by Eddie Howe. And thatâs a real possibility, with the Newcastle coach high on the lists from the bookies.
One person who would be in favour is Paul Merson. His piece from the Metro today makes it very clear heâs a fan of the former Bournemouth coachâs:
âIâm a big fan of Eddie Howe. If Eddie Howe leaves Newcastle, theyâll be queueing up around the corner for him.
âHeâs just had injuries and with the [Alexander] Isak thing at the end of the season. I think Eddie has done enough to decide whatever he wants at the club. I think thereâs a genuine love for him up there.â
